Hello, I'm looking for a basic script that on command enables a person to IM another person. Example: There's a car another person made, let's call him Bob Linden. I want a person to be able to select, in the menu, to contact Bob Linden and I via IM. Is this possible? Also, if it is, could I have a script for it?

There's currently no way to open an IM window through a script. It may be possible to set up a system involving mouselook, a sensor, and a "/<channel>" chatline command to IM an object's owner (but not creator)... but really, using something like that would be much more trouble than simply looking up the person in Find and opening an IM window from there.
